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- Considering the high incidence of myopia - and its inherent morbidit- it may wonder that the item is dealt with only sporadically in recent literature, and almost never at international conferences. However, there was a First International Conferen…ce on Myopia in New York 1964, and the Second was held in Yokohama 1978, affiliated to the XXIII World Congress of Ophthalmology. Here it was attempted to set out lines for future myopia research, and, as a practical implicaton, the arrange ment of the Third International Conference on Myopia was entrusted to Danish ophthalmolOgists. This conference took place in Copenhagen, August 24-27, 1980. To make the scope the widest possible, the conference was, as was the pre decessing in Japan, open not only to ophthalmologists, but 'to all being active in the various aspects of myopia research'. The conference report gives a picture of the Copenhagen meeting. Furthermore, a platform or current status of myopia research has hereby been established. The editors have made it their main task to arrange the papers, and to bring them in a form suited for print, while criticism by editorial referees has been considered inappropriate. The papers give an impression of the ambiguity still prevailing in the field, and although 't,rends' are obvious, a fmal consensus of Conference was not arrived at. To document this state of affairs, however, is considered a useful task.

Ernst Philip Goldschmidt (1887-1954) was a Viennese-born antiquarian bookseller, scholar and bibliophile. Goldschmidt's landmark study of Gothic and Renaissance European bookbindings was based on his celebrated personal collection. Volume I comprises an extensive Introduction, followed by the Catalogue Raisonné, a numbered descriptive catalogue of Goldschmidt's collection arranged chronologically and geographically (268 entries). Goldschmidt's preface records the origins of the project in his undergraduate cataloguing of the Trinity College, Cambridge, bindings and acknowledges the numerous scholars and librarians who provided access to collections and rubbings. The volume concludes with a Synopsis of the Collection and extensive indexes. Volume II contains 110 plates (I-CX, including several sub-numbered plates), reproducing photographs and rubbings of bindings. Three additional plates appear in the text volume. A foundational and still indispensable reference on early European bookbinding, particularly valuable for the study and identification of Gothic and Renaissance panel-stamped, roll-tooled, and monastic bindings, their workshops, tools, and provenance.

Published in 1943, "Medieval Texts and their First Appearance in Print" is a landmark work of scholarship on the incunabula period. The author offers a comprehensive surve…y of the medieval texts, tracing their origins and examining their significance for the history of printing and the dissemination of knowledge. With a wealth of detail and a keen eye for historical context, Goldschmidt illuminates the complex interplay between manuscript culture and the emerging print industry, providing valuable insights into the early history of the book. This book remains an essential reference work for scholars, students, and anyone interested in the history of printing, manuscript culture, and medieval literature.
